Sizing and Venting Done Right in Lyons

Fan sizing follows a simple rule: roughly 1 CFM (cubic feet per minute) per square foot of bathroom floor area. A 60-square-foot bathroom needs at least a 60 CFM fan. Larger bathrooms or those with separate toilet compartments may need more.

Quiet models worth considering include the Panasonic WhisperCeiling, Broan, and Delta lines. Many run at 1.0 sone or below — essentially silent during normal use.

The vent duct must exit the home through a roof cap, soffit cap, or exterior wall cap. It must never terminate in the attic. Venting into the attic pushes moist air into the framing and insulation, leading to rot, mold, and structural damage over time. Do Lyons Homeowners Need an Electrician?

It depends on the scope of work. A like-for-like swap — pulling the old fan and connecting the new one to existing wiring — is standard handyman work. No licensed electrician is required for that job.

Running a brand-new electrical circuit from the panel is a different matter. That is licensed electrical work. Rules vary by state, but in Illinois, new circuit work generally requires a licensed electrician. Where does a bathroom exhaust fan vent to — can it go into the attic?

No. A bathroom exhaust fan must always vent to the outside of the home. Acceptable termination points include a roof cap, a soffit cap, or an exterior wall cap. Venting into the attic pushes warm, moist air directly into the framing, insulation, and roof sheathing. Over time, that moisture causes rot, mold growth, and structural damage — problems that cost far more to fix than proper venting does upfront. Some older Lyons homes have fans that were originally installed venting into the attic, which is a code violation. What size bathroom exhaust fan do I need for my Lyons bathroom?

The standard rule is approximately 1 CFM (cubic feet per minute) of airflow for every square foot of bathroom floor space. A 50-square-foot bathroom needs at least a 50 CFM fan, and a 80-square-foot bathroom needs at least an 80 CFM unit. Bathrooms with vaulted ceilings, a separate toilet compartment, or a large soaking tub may benefit from a higher CFM rating. For noise, look for fans rated at 1.0 sone or below — models like the Panasonic WhisperCeiling, Broan, and Delta lines are reliable quiet options.
